IUJ’s MBA Program Ranks #1 in Japan in the Economist’s MBA Ranking 2021

The Economist recently published its 2021 MBA rankings, and IUJ’s MBA Program was listed as one of the world’s top 100 business schools.  IUJ’s MBA Program is the ONLY school from Japan to be included in this ranking. The overall rank moved up to #73, and among schools in Asia ranks #7.

In addition to being #73 in the world overall, IUJ achieved positive results from the following key ranking category:

《 Percentage of job-seeking graduates with job offer 3 months after graduation:  #4 》
